The M-690 includes an independent 3-band Dynamic EQ.
Unlike a conventional EQ that applies the same correction all the time, Dynamic EQ can change the amount of processing according to signal level.
Adjustable parameters include:
This provides an additional layer of control for frequencies that become excessive only when the system is played louder.
The M-690 provides up to 150ms of adjustable Music Delay.
Modern TVs, projectors, streaming devices, and video processors can introduce video latency. The adjustable delay allows the audio signal to be synchronized more accurately with the picture.
This is particularly useful when the same system is used for both karaoke and TV entertainment.

Brand: AC
Model: M-690
Product Type: High-End Professional Karaoke DSP Processor
Music EQ: 15-Band Parametric EQ
Music Dynamic EQ: 3-Band
Microphone EQ: Dual Independent 20-Band Parametric EQ
Microphone Feedback Suppression: 4 Levels
Microphone Noise Gate: Yes
Vocal Effects: Advanced Stereo Echo + Stereo Reverb
Effect EQ: 7-Band Parametric EQ per Effect Section
Output Channels: 6
Output EQ: 10-Band Parametric EQ per Output Section
Output Processing: Level, Mix, Mute, HPF/LPF, Crossover, Delay and Limiter
Maximum Music Delay: 150ms
Maximum Output Delay: 50ms
Analog Audio Inputs: 2 × Stereo RCA
Digital Audio Inputs: Optical + Coaxial
Bluetooth: Bluetooth 5.0
Balanced Audio Outputs: 6 × XLR
2.1 Support: Main L/R + Dedicated Subwoofer Output
PC Control: Driver-Free USB
Wireless Control: Wi-Fi
Spectrum Analysis: Yes
DSP Configurations: Up to 16
Software Password: Yes
Control Lock: Yes
Maximum Music Input Level: 7Vrms
Maximum Microphone Input Level: 730mVrms
Maximum Output Level: 7Vrms
Microphone Signal-to-Noise Ratio: 121dB
Music Signal-to-Noise Ratio: 118dB
Dimensions: 19.1 W × 8.7 D × 1.75 H in
(485 × 220 × 44.5 mm)
Net Weight: 8.6 lb (3.9 kg)
Shipping Weight: 9.9 lb (4.5 kg)
